Velho do Rio is a Brazilian musical group that formed in the early 2000s, drawing from the Pantanal region's traditions. Their song 'O Pantanal' became something of an anthem for the area. The band's lineup includes João Moreno on vocals and guitar, Ricardo Pereira on accordion and vocals, Rafael Goés on bass and vocals, and Marcos Batista on drums and percussion.
Their music incorporates Pantanal rhythms with contemporary arrangements. They've released albums like 'Velho do Rio,' 'Chão de Pantanal,' and 'Alma do Bioma,' which touch on nature and life in the region. Songs such as 'A Tanto Tempo,' 'Ciência do Chão,' and 'Da Água Doce' reflect these themes.
Velho do Rio has worked with various Brazilian and international musicians, which brought different sounds into their music. Their approach has influenced other artists in Brazil, showing how traditional and modern styles can come together.
